This print captures the exquisite craftsmanship of the wooden door adorning the Monastery of St. Sabina in Rome. Dating back to approximately 1890, this timeless piece of art showcases the mastery of applied arts and crafts during that era. The wooden door stands as a testament to architectural brilliance, serving as a portal into a world steeped in history and spirituality. Its intricate design features various building elements meticulously carved into its surface, including decorative sections and columns that add an air of grandeur to its overall composition.
